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/asp.net/37.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ript 请求中缺少只读文本框。表单集合_Javascript_Asp.net - Fatal编程技术网

Javascript 请求中缺少只读文本框。表单集合

Javascript 请求中缺少只读文本框。表单集合,javascript,asp.net,Javascript,Asp.net,在我的一个页面中,有几个文本框根据用户选择设置为只读。回发期间,Request.Form集合中缺少所有这些按钮 我不知道为什么会这样。但是,我几乎没试过什么 a) 禁用文本框或将其设置为只读意味着回发集合中将缺少控件。 b) 如果视图状态设置为true,则仅发布第一个只读控件。其他国家仍然失败。 c) 在回发之前尝试手动启用控件。没有变化 所以,在这里,我试图找到一些想法进行测试 成功的控件将发布到服务器。禁用的控件不是成功的控件,但是只读控件通常被视为成功的控件。 您还可以打开浏览器调试器并查

在我的一个页面中,有几个文本框根据用户选择设置为只读。回发期间,Request.Form集合中缺少所有这些按钮

我不知道为什么会这样。但是,我几乎没试过什么

a) 禁用文本框或将其设置为只读意味着回发集合中将缺少控件。 b) 如果视图状态设置为true,则仅发布第一个只读控件。其他国家仍然失败。 c) 在回发之前尝试手动启用控件。没有变化


所以,在这里,我试图找到一些想法进行测试

成功的控件将发布到服务器。禁用的控件不是成功的控件,但是只读控件通常被视为成功的控件。
您还可以打开浏览器调试器并查看网络标题,以查看该特定请求/表单提交的提交元素。

您可以参考。

谢谢。我查过了。系统将只读控件视为不成功控件,因为某些傻瓜禁用了页面属性中的视图状态。不知道,为什么需要回发的页面应该具有该属性。但是,删除该属性后,request.form现在就可以工作了。谢谢你给我指出了网络头的正确方向。